Smart and sustainable cities is an interdisciplinary field that addresses the use of digital technologies, data systems, and integrated planning approaches to improve urban life while reducing environmental impact. It connects urban planning, civil engineering, information technology, environmental management, public policy, and social science to tackle challenges in transport, energy, water management, waste, housing, and civic participation. Master's-level programs in this area typically cover smart city frameworks and governance models, sensor networks and the internet of things in urban infrastructure, geographic information systems, urban data analytics, sustainable mobility, energy efficiency in buildings and districts, and the design of participatory processes for city planning. Graduates work in municipal administrations, urban technology firms, infrastructure consultancies, international development agencies, and research institutes focused on urban transformation. This one-year master's degree in Ciudades Inteligentes Y Sostenibles is offered by the Complutense University of Madrid in Madrid, Spain, with annual tuition of €2,701.20.

About Complutense University of Madrid

Complutense University of Madrid is one of Spain's oldest and most prestigious universities, with roots tracing back to the 13th century and a large modern community of around 72,000 students, including approximately 7,000 international learners. Located in the vibrant capital, the university offers a broad range of undergraduate, postgraduate and doctoral programs across humanities, social sciences, natural sciences and health disciplines. Its scale and history create a rich academic atmosphere that blends rigorous scholarship with cultural and intellectual life.

Students at Complutense benefit from extensive libraries, well-equipped research centers and a diverse faculty actively involved in national and international projects.
